Output 51fbbc93fc740bb5733e95bb3e3f2741aefe076f6fceae646c7df0fc3a39c428:0

value
25809569179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ac95be80955fccf940d43f63d760fc89e35ecee7 OP_EQUAL
address
3HRZXwjYJK48pnz1vDGy3nDCca8DnZx4Wu
transaction
51fbbc93fc740bb5733e95bb3e3f2741aefe076f6fceae646c7df0fc3a39c428
spent
true